STEM Lesson Plans

Search our growing library of STEM lesson plans. Arizona teachers are contributing their best STEM lesson plans to an archive that is aligned with Arizona Academic Standards. This repository is provided free of charge through a collaboration with the Arizona Educational Foundation.
